Transaction fb3cc10324b475b85f1dc11ff04e6836061f3355930f260145eab1d46bb3ecd2
1 Input
1 Output
-
fb3cc10324b475b85f1dc11ff04e6836061f3355930f260145eab1d46bb3ecd2:0
- value
- 344074
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e08fb1c856ec279169d2aa383a775e41e8f4e075 OP_EQUAL
- address
- 3NAPRabiduqjzmCsxsB9ggJvnUMH87ED27